What to Expect?

Components of a Psychoeducational report will include: Background Information

Assessment Tools

Test Batteries administered and questionnaires used which will assess Function, Attention/Behaviour, and Cognitive Ability/Memory Skills:

 

 

 

  • Functioning:
    • Academic
      • Determining students Proficiency in Reading, Writing, and Math
      • ​Executive
        • The different cognitive processes the students use to connect past experiences with present actions as well as control personal behavior.
        • This function is used by students to plan, organize, strategize, remember details, as well as awareness of space and time.
      • Adaptive
        • Competence of daily skills used in everyday life such as grooming, dressing, bathing, and more.
    • Attention and Behavior:
      • Hyperactivity, Inattention, Impulsivity, Social or thought problem, anxiety, depression, aggression, Leadership
    • Cognitive Ability and Memory Skills:
      • Verbal Comprehension, Short Term Memory, Long Term Verbal Memory, Working and Visual Memory, Processing Speed and Visual Motor Coordination
